Description
In the Sydney suburb of Centennial Park, two nurses, a housekeeper, and a solicitor attend to Elizabeth Hunter as her expatriate son and daughter convene at her deathbed. But in dying, as in living, Mrs. Hunter remains a powerful force on those who surround her. Based on the novel by Nobel prize winner Patrick White, The Eye of the Storm is a savage exploration of family relationships, and the sharp undercurrents of love and hate, comedy and tragedy, which define them.
